What is a voltage divider?

A voltage divider is a passive linear circuit that produces an output voltage (Vout) that is a fraction of its input voltage (V1). Voltage dividers are used to adjust signal levels, bias active devices and amplifiers, and measure voltages.

Ohm's lawrelates voltage, current, and resistance — the current through a conductor between two points is proportional to the potential difference between them.

This law describes the relationship between the voltage difference between two points, the current flowing between them, and the resistance of the current path. It is expressed as V = IR, where V is the voltage difference, I is the current in amperes, and R is the resistance in ohms. For a known voltage, the larger the resistance, the smaller the current.
